I present to you the Turtle diagram, which is a great tool for building and managing processes, but also for understanding them. The tool may be useful for:
requirements elicitation (Business Analysts),
process design ( Process Designers),
brainstorming (Quality Team meetings) and,
audits (internal and external Auditors).
The diagram consists of identifications basic of data such as:
name
input and
output of the process.
Additionally, it allows you to name and assign information related to the process, answering questions such as:
what is necessary to perform process?
who is performing process?
how is the process performing?
measures? what is the goal and what kind of KPIs we use?
In the case of more complex problems or more detailed requirements, a perspective on the risks that may occur in the process can be added.

The Fishbone Diagram template, also known as the Ishikawa or Cause-and-Effect diagram, offers a visual tool for identifying and analyzing root causes of problems or issues. It provides a structured framework for categorizing potential causes into major categories such as people, process, environment, and equipment. This template enables teams to conduct root cause analysis systematically, facilitating problem-solving and decision-making. By promoting a structured approach to problem analysis, the Fishbone Diagram empowers teams to address issues effectively and implement corrective actions efficiently.
